Use the Closet Space

When you get to your hotel room you should unpack your clothes. Using the closet space will be the best way to keep your clothes organized. It’s also a great way to make sure that they don’t get wrinkled in your suitcase. 

Extended stay hotels will most likely have better closet space accommodations with more hangers. If not, then you can always ask the front desk for a few more hangers.

One of our favorite tips for living in a hotel is to talk with the front desk as they will be a great resource for making your extended stay as comfortable as possible. 

Make sure that you keep your closet organized throughout your stay as this will be mainly where you want to keep all of your belongings. 

Resist Using the Drawers

On the other hand, you might want to put your things in the drawers of your hotel room. If you feel confident in doing this, then go right ahead. It’s a great place to keep your things and stay organized. 

The main problem with keeping your things in the hotel’s drawers is that you might leave a thing or two behind when it comes time to leave. After spending a lot of time during your stay in the hotel you may leave a few things in the drawers when you’re packing to go home. This can be a huge inconvenience.  

Instead of using the drawers, you can leave a few items that don’t need to be hung in the closet in your suitcase. Prop your suitcase on the rack so that it is easy to get in and out of. This way you won’t leave anything behind when it comes time to leave.

Keep Your Dirty Laundry Together

One of the best tips to living in an extended stay hotel is to make sure that you bring some type of dirty laundry hamper. They make perfect travel-sized hampers that fold up and can easily be thrown into your suitcase. One of these would be perfect to invest in especially if you travel for an extended amount of time a lot. 

Doing laundry during your stay is going to be a must so you will want it to be organized. Make sure to talk with the front desk and see the best way to get your laundry done. 

Sometimes you can send your laundry out to have it done but that can get expensive. Most extended stay hotels will have a laundry room on the premises for you to use. Sometimes it might cost money and other times it could be free depending on the hotel. 

Doing your laundry is an important part of staying organized. This is especially important if you’re going to be staying at a hotel for weeks at a time.

Bring a Power Strip

The most common item left behind in a hotel is a cell phone charger. It is something easily forgotten and easily replaceable but can be a bit of an inconvenient hassle when you do. 

A great way to make sure that you don’t forget any of the chargers for your electronic devices is to keep them all in one place by bringing a power strip.

If you need to charge your laptop, tablet, smartphone, and camera, then your devices could be spread out all over the room at different outlets. With a power strip, you can keep all of your chargers and devices in one place. 

When it is time to pack up and leave, then you can grab your power strip with all of your devices’ chargers and you’ll be ready to go.
